Fact Checks (3)
"The recent presidential polls were so inaccurate when it came to me"
Mostly True

2020 national polls showed Biden +7-10 points; he won the popular vote by ~4.5%. State-level polls were systematically biased in key battleground states. AAPOR's 2021 report confirmed this was among the worst polling cycles in modern history, with Trump consistently underpolled.

"Polls are FAKE (deliberately fabricated)"
False

Post-election analysis attributed polling error to underrepresentation of non-college white voters, possible social desirability effects ('shy Trump voters'), and herding among pollsters. These are methodological failures, not deliberate fabrication. No credible evidence of intentional polling fraud was identified.
